Main subject categories: • Partial Differential Equations • Ordinary Differential EquationsMathematics Subject Classification (2010): • 35A01 Existence problems for PDEs: global existence, local existence, non-existence • 35A02 Uniqueness problems for PDEs: global uniqueness, local uniqueness, non-uniqueness • 35J05 Laplace operator, Helmholtz equation (reduced wave equation), Poisson equation • 35J25 Boundary value problems for second-order elliptic equations• 35K05 • 35L05 Wave equation • 35Q30 Navier-Stokes equations • 35Q35 PDEs in connection with fluid mechanics • 35S05 Pseudodifferential operators as generalizations of partial differential operatorsThis second in the series of three volumes builds upon the basic theory of linear PDE given in volume 1, and pursues more advanced topics. Analytical tools introduced here include pseudodifferential operators, the functional analysis of self-adjoint operators, and Wiener measure. The book also develops basic differential geometrical concepts, centred about curvature.
